Output b0d6c10b595736e02cd96e7952502018d58f7ca7eb59cb6723dbdce6986a6d8c:3

value
68000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6ee315e74716a59b43410df997c0c34014feba OP_EQUAL
address
3PX2FxZSHCBc4qW3kuMoJru6z6vc87Kr5g
transaction
b0d6c10b595736e02cd96e7952502018d58f7ca7eb59cb6723dbdce6986a6d8c
confirmations
211429
spent
true